Hyderabad, June 17 -- Conditions are favourable for the further advance of the Southwest Monsoon into more parts of the Central Arabian Sea, Telangana, Odisha, Jharkhand, Bihar and Chhattisgarh during the next four to five days, the Meteorological Centre said on Wednesday.
In its daily weather report, the Centre said thunderstorms accompanied by lightning and gusty winds with speeds of 40-50 kmph are likely to occur at isolated places across Telangana during the next seven days.
Light to moderate rain or thundershowers are also likely at isolated places over the state during the same period.
